Get a cyclocomputer.Buy in person from a bicycle store.Check what speed they go to by reading the spec sheet in the packet before buying.Some go to 100kmh,some to 200kmh and a few to 300kmh.The one I show in the pic is an Echowell U12 ,it reads on the odo display to 200kmh but the maximum speed display goes above 300kmh.Mph can be selected.

Today i collected and fitted the G2 throttle tamer. Bearing in mind that i was already satisfied with the throttle due to having fitted a DNA Air filter....I felt like i was on a different bike. The throttle is now super-smooth in all modes, at all speeds. Couldn't catch it out. Went through my usual bends and twists smoother and faster....didn't get stung by customs and took 7 days to arrive...Really impressed!
